InterGlobe Enterprises, which owns India's largest airline IndiGo, and Archer Aviation on November 9 announced that they have entered into a memorandum of understanding (MoU) with the goal of partnering to launch and operate an all-electric air taxi service in India.

The partnership plans to finance the purchase of up to 200 of Archer’s Midnight aircraft for the India operations. The Midnight aircraft is a piloted, four-passenger electric vertical takeoff and landing aircraft designed to perform rapid back-to-back flights with minimal charge time between flights.

The InterGlobe-Archer flight will allow their customers to fly the 27-km Delhi trip from Connaught Place to Gurugram, typically taking 60 to 90 minutes by car, in approximately 7 minutes.

The low-noise electric air taxi service is a safe, sustainable, and cost competitive solution with ground transportation.
